/// <summary> /// Creates an Elastic Pool /// </summary> public Management.Sql.Models.ElasticPool Create(string resourceGroupName, string serverName, string elasticPoolName, Management.Sql.Models.ElasticPool parameters) { // Occasionally after PUT elastic pool, if we poll for operation results immediately then // the polling may fail with 404. This is mitigated in the client by adding a brief wait. var client = GetCurrentSqlClient(); AzureOperationResponse <Management.Sql.Models.ElasticPool> createOrUpdateResponse = client.ElasticPools.BeginCreateOrUpdateWithHttpMessagesAsync( resourceGroupName, serverName, elasticPoolName, parameters).Result; // Sleep 5 seconds TestMockSupport.Delay(5000); return(client.GetPutOrPatchOperationResultAsync( createOrUpdateResponse, null, CancellationToken.None).Result.Body); }
